(1c) In addition, the road traffic authorities shall designate, in agreement with the local authority, 30 kph zones within built-up areas, especially in residential areas and areas with a high density of pedestrians and pedal cyclists and where a large number of persons have to cross the road. (4) Regular service buses and school buses marked as such which are waiting at stops (sign 224) and have switched on their hazard warning lights may be passed only at walking pace and only at such a distance as to rule out any danger to the passengers. Warning signs may be installed only where this is necessary to ensure traffic safety because even an alert road user cannot recognize the danger, or cannot recognize it in good time, and cannot be expected to anticipate it. (3) Goods vehicles with a maximum authorized mass exceeding 7.5 tonnes as well as trailers towed by goods vehicles must not be operated between midnight and 10 p.m. on Sundays and public holidays. Subsequently, at least one clearly visible warning sign must be put up at a sufficient distance in the case of fast-moving traffic at a distance of about 100 metres; prescribed safety devices such as warning triangles are to be used.
